Each module concludes with a quiz to reinforce learning, culminating in a comprehensive end test and a professional certificate upon successful completion. Here's a glimpse of what awaits you:
- Module 1-5: Spyder Foundations: Get a rock-solid understanding of the Spyder IDE, from installation and configuration to mastering its core features. You'll learn how to navigate the interface, manage projects, and leverage debugging tools for efficient coding.
- Module 6-15: Python Essentials for Forensics: Dive into Python programming, focusing on libraries critical for forensics, like Pandas, NumPy, and Scikit-learn. You’ll learn how to manipulate data, perform statistical analysis, and build machine learning models for anomaly detection.
- Module 16-25: Data Acquisition and Parsing: Master techniques for extracting data from various sources, including disk images, memory dumps, and network traffic captures. Learn to parse complex file formats and extract relevant information using Spyder's scripting capabilities.
- Module 26-35: Artifact Analysis and Correlation: Discover how to identify and analyze key forensic artifacts, such as registry entries, event logs, and web browser history. You'll learn to correlate these artifacts to reconstruct events and establish timelines using Spyder's data visualization tools.
- Module 36-45: Malware Analysis with Spyder: Uncover the secrets of malware analysis by disassembling and reverse-engineering malicious code within Spyder. Identify malicious behavior, extract indicators of compromise (IOCs), and develop countermeasures.
- Module 46-55: Network Forensics and Packet Analysis: Analyze network traffic captures (PCAP files) with Spyder to identify suspicious activity and reconstruct network events. You'll learn to extract valuable information from network protocols and identify potential security breaches.
- Module 56-65: Advanced Data Visualization Techniques: Go beyond basic charts and graphs. Master advanced data visualization techniques to uncover hidden patterns and relationships within complex forensic datasets. Create interactive dashboards to present your findings effectively.
- Module 66-75: Automation and Scripting for Efficiency: Develop powerful scripts and tools to automate repetitive forensic tasks, saving you valuable time and resources. You'll learn to create custom modules and integrate them into your existing workflow.
- Module 76-80: Capstone Project: Real-World Case Simulation: Put your newfound skills to the test with a challenging capstone project based on a real-world digital forensics scenario. You'll apply all the techniques you've learned to analyze evidence, identify suspects, and build a compelling case.
